Understanding Stock Photos
To comprehend the value of royalty free stock pictures , it's essential to understand what they are. Stock photos are pre-shot pictures made available for licensing, enabling individuals and businesses to purchase and use them for various purposes. These images cover a wide range of subjects, from everyday objects and people to landscapes and abstract concepts.
The Pros of Stock Photos
1. Convenience and Accessibility: One of the significant advantages of stock pictures is their availability and easy accessibility. Rather than spending time and resources arranging a photoshoot, you can find a stock image that fits your needs with just a few clicks. This convenience makes stock photos a great option when you're working against tight deadlines.
2. Cost-Effective: Hiring a professional photographer or purchasing equipment can be expensive, especially for small businesses or bloggers on a budget. Stock photos offer a cost-effective alternative, as they are usually available for a fraction of the cost of a custom photoshoot. Additionally, many stock photo websites offer affordable subscription plans or a pay-per-image model, ensuring flexibility for different budgets.
3. Wide Selection: Stock photo libraries boast extensive collections, featuring millions of images covering a broad range of subjects. This variety allows you to find the perfect image for your specific needs, no matter the industry or purpose of your project. Whether you're in need of a picture of a smiling employee, a tranquil beach scene, or an abstract background, stock photos have got you covered.
4. High-Quality Images: Over the years, stock photo libraries have significantly improved their offerings, ensuring high-quality images that meet professional standards. Many photographers contribute to these platforms, adding their expertise and creativity to the pool of available photos. As a result, you can find sharp, well-composed images that can enhance the overall look and feel of your project.
The Cons of Stock Photos
1. Lack of Authenticity: One of the most common criticisms of stock photos is their lack of authenticity. Since these images are available to anyone, you may come across the same pictures being used in various contexts, diminishing their uniqueness. Additionally, staged and artificially posed shots can sometimes feel cliché and detached from reality, leading to a lack of genuine connection with the audience.
2. Limited Customization: While stock photos provide a wide selection, it's important to note that they may not perfectly align with your specific requirements. It can be challenging to find an image that accurately represents your brand or conveys the precise message you want to deliver. Customization options such as altering the image or background may also be limited, preventing you from truly making it your own.
3. Overused Images: As stock photos are accessible to anyone, there is a risk of overusing certain images that have become popular or trendy. This overexposure can lead to a sense of staleness or repetition in marketing campaigns or website designs. To maintain a fresh and unique look, it's crucial to be mindful of the trends and choose images that haven't been widely used before.
4. Finding the Right Fit: Despite the vast selection available, finding the perfect stock image for your project can be time-consuming. It often requires skimming through countless pages, using specific filters, or dealing with irrelevant search results. This process can be frustrating, especially if you're short on time or have a specific vision in mind.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I use stock photos for commercial purposes?Yes, stock photos can be used for commercial purposes, including websites, advertisements, and marketing campaigns. However, the usage rights vary depending on the licensing agreement of each stock photo website. Always check the terms and conditions or license agreement before using any image commercially.
2. Can I modify stock photos to fit my needs?
Most stock photo websites allow minor modifications to the images, such as cropping, resizing, or adding text overlays. However, extensive modifications or editing may be prohibited or require additional licensing. It's best to review the terms and conditions of each website to fully understand the limitations on modifying stock photos.
3. How do I choose the right stock photo for my project?
Choosing the right stock photo involves considering your project's purpose and target audience. Think about the emotions or messages you want to convey and look for images that align with your brand's aesthetics. It can also be helpful to browse through different stock photo websites to compare image styles and find the best fit for your project.
4. What are some alternative options to stock photos?
If you're looking for more unique visuals, there are alternative options to stock photos available. Hiring a professional photographer for a custom photoshoot allows you to have exclusive images tailored specifically to your brand. Additionally, you can explore user-generated content through social media platforms or collaborate with illustrators or graphic designers to create custom illustrations or graphics.
5. Are there any copyright concerns with stock photos?
Using stock photos from reputable platforms should minimize the risk of copyright infringement. However, it's crucial to adhere to the licensing terms and not use the images outside of their allowed usage rights. To ensure compliance, always read and understand the license agreement and seek legal advice if needed.
